Mandatory evacuation was announced for 37 settlements of the Kupyansky district of the Kharkiv region in connection with the increased shelling of the occupying Russian army.

This was announced on August 10 by the Kupyansk city military administration in a Telegram.
Mandatory evacuation of the population begins in the de-occupied territories of the Kupyansky district of the Kharkiv region. This order was signed on August 9 by the TIO of the head of the Kupyansk regional military administration, Andrei Kanashevich, the report says.
Forced evacuation was announced from the territory of settlements close to the combat zone, Dvorichanskaya village, Petropavlovsk rural, partly from the territories of Kondrashevskaya rural, Kurilovskaya rural and Kupyanskaya urban territorial communities.
On the territory of the Kupyansk city territorial society, mandatory evacuation has been announced for residents of the city of Kupyansk Zaoskillya (left bank of the Oskol River), town. Kovsharovka, Kupyansk – Uzlovy.
